Novartis India to acquire Pfizer trademarks for INR 1,250 crore

Novartis India has approved the acquisition of the ‘Minipress’ and ‘Minipres’ trademarks from Pfizer Inc. and Pfizer Products Inc. for INR 1,250 crore. The deal includes the assignment of specific related intellectual property rights in India.

Following a global manufacturing halt by Pfizer Inc., Pfizer Ltd announced it will discontinue the marketing, distribution, and sale of Minipress XL in India. The medication, which contains the active ingredient prazosin, is used to treat hypertension and manage urinary symptoms related to benign prostatic hyperplasia.

Data indicates that Minipress XL recorded revenues of INR 228.6 crore as of July 2026, maintaining a compound annual growth rate of 6.3 per cent over the last four years. Following the announcement, Novartis India shares saw a 4 per cent increase.
